Well I was finally able to purchase a set of the Hamann HM4 wheels from Bavarian Autosport. I wanted to get some feedback on the looks. The only problem I ran into was using the factory 205/45/17 Dunlop run flats. The 205/45/17 tire is not designed to be installed on a rim larger than 7.5". I just purchased a set of 215/40/17 Yokohama Parada Spec II's from TireRack. This is the maxium size that Hamann recommends using. For those of you looking for a great looking wheel and the need to purchase a new set of rubber, the Hamann is for you. If you want to keep your factory tires and save weight, there are plenty of other wheels out there for a lot less money!

bonz,

I believe the offset is 43mm. The factory offset for the S-Lite's were 50mm. No rubbing issues at all. I looked up your wheels on the Antera web page and it looks like they have an offset of 35mm. My wheels come out right to the edge of the fender flare. This is mainly due to the fact that they are 8" wide. The only thing I would be cautious about is the chance that the Antera 309's are going to stick out past the fender. Do they guarantee that this will not happen after you receive them?
